Top 10 High Paying Majors in College

Which major to select affects the income earning potential post college. The majors highlighted below have relatively high paying job opportunities and substantial demand in employment markets, creating room for more growth opportunities:

«  Computer Science

A degree in computer science opens doors to high-paying careers in software development, cybersecurity, and artificial intelligence. The tech industry is ever-evolving, with roles like software engineer, data analyst, and IT specialist consistently in demand.

 

«  Engineering (Various Branches)

Engineering disciplines such as electrical, mechanical, civil, and aerospace engineering offer excellent earning potential. Engineers solve complex problems and drive innovation, making them indispensable across industries.

 

«  Data Science

With businesses relying heavily on data-driven decisions, data scientists are among the most sought-after professionals. This major equips students with skills in statistics, machine learning, and data visualization, leading to high-paying roles in tech and finance.

 

«  Mathematics

Mathematics graduates find opportunities in diverse fields, including finance, technology, and education. Professions like actuary, quantitative analyst, and operations research analyst offer lucrative salaries and job stability.

 

«  Physics

Physics majors often pursue careers in research, engineering, or technology. The problem-solving and analytical skills developed in this field make graduates valuable in industries like aerospace, renewable energy, and even finance.

 

«  Finance

A finance degree prepares students for roles in investment banking, financial planning, and corporate finance. With experience, professionals in this field can achieve six-figure salaries and leadership positions.

 

«  Business Administration

This versatile major offers a broad understanding of business operations, leading to roles in management, marketing, and entrepreneurship. The potential for growth and high earnings is great, especially in leadership positions.

 

«  Accounting

Accountants are indispensable to handle financial records, ensure compliance, and advise on financial strategies. A degree in accounting may lead to stable, high-paying jobs, especially for those who earn certifications like CPA.

 

«  Medicine

One of the best-paid professions is medicine. Surgeons, anesthesiologists, and general practitioners headline a list of some of the highest salaries. While the educational pathway in this field is very long, significant financial and social rewards await.

 

«  Dentistry

Dentists enjoy very high earning potential and very secure jobs. Qualifying to practice dentistry can lead either directly into private practice or to specializations such as orthodontics or oral surgery, which also command very high salaries.

Each of these majors requires dedication and hard work, but they also provide pathways to rewarding careers. When choosing your major, consider not only potential earnings but also your interests and long-term goals to ensure a fulfilling career.
